Hi, I'm Nick Porter (@jacione).

  • 👨‍🎓 I'm currently working toward a PhD in physics at Brigham Young University.
  • 👀 I’m interested in computational imaging, algorithm development, device interfacing, experiment automation.
  • ⌨ I'm pretty good with Python and LaTeX, with a vague grasp of C, C++, Javascript, and a few other languages.
  • 🌱 I’m currently learning about linguistics in my spare time. Fascinating subject.
